Output 89e7611c031b61fc35b1708bde7a626d74a89d7185e4def6caf9dc6879188598:5

value
993619
script pubkey
OP_0 OP_PUSHBYTES_20 587e6b0ea0102b13b5745fb0454ef791d0548e2c
address
ltc1qtplxkr4qzq438dt5t7cy2nhhj8g9fr3vs6h764
transaction
89e7611c031b61fc35b1708bde7a626d74a89d7185e4def6caf9dc6879188598
spent
true